电子签证支付系统概述
电子签证(e-Visa)支付系统是现代出入境管理的重要组成部分,它允许申请人在网上完成签证申请和支付流程,无需前往使领馆或签证中心。随着全球数字化进程加速,越来越多的国家推出了电子签证系统,如印度、土耳其、澳大利亚、新西兰等。
电子签证支付系统的基本组成
- 申请平台:各国移民局或外交部的官方网站
- 支付网关:集成的第三方支付系统(如PayPal、Stripe、信用卡支付)
- 验证系统:用于验证申请人身份和支付信息
- 通知系统:通过电子邮件或短信发送支付确认和签证批准通知
电子签证支付系统的操作复杂度分析
操作复杂度评估
电子签证支付系统的操作复杂度因国家而异,但总体上可以分为三个层次:
1. 简单型系统(操作简单)
- 代表国家:新西兰、澳大利亚
- 特点:
- 界面简洁,步骤明确
- 支持多种支付方式
- 有清晰的指引和帮助文档
- 支持中文界面(部分国家)
2. 中等复杂度系统
- 代表国家:土耳其、印度
- 特点:
- 需要填写较多信息
- 支付流程可能涉及多个页面
- 需要上传多种文件
- 部分系统不支持中文界面
3. 复杂型系统
- 代表国家:某些非洲和南美国家
- 特点:
- 界面设计不够友好
- 支付方式有限
- 技术问题较多
- 缺乏多语言支持
影响操作复杂度的因素
- 界面设计:直观的界面能显著降低操作难度
- 语言支持:母语界面能减少理解障碍
- 支付方式:支持多种支付方式(信用卡、借记卡、电子钱包)更方便
- 系统稳定性:稳定的系统减少操作中断
- 帮助文档:详细的FAQ和指引能帮助用户解决问题
如何快速完成电子签证支付流程
前期准备(关键步骤)
1. 材料准备清单
- 有效护照(有效期至少6个月)
- 近期证件照(符合要求的尺寸和格式)
- 旅行行程证明(机票预订、酒店预订)
- 财务证明(银行对账单、信用卡)
- 其他特定文件(根据目的地要求)
2. 技术准备
- 浏览器选择:推荐使用Chrome、Firefox或Safari的最新版本
- 网络环境:确保稳定的网络连接
- 支付工具:准备好有效的信用卡/借记卡或电子钱包账户
- 邮箱准备:使用常用邮箱,确保能正常接收邮件
分步操作指南
第一步:访问官方申请网站
重要提示:
- 务必通过官方渠道访问,避免钓鱼网站
- 检查网址是否以
.gov或官方域名结尾 - 查看网站是否有安全锁标志(HTTPS)
示例:印度电子签证申请
官方网址:https://indianvisaonline.gov.in
第二步:填写申请表
技巧:
- 分段填写:不要一次性填写所有内容,可以分段保存
- 使用自动填充:浏览器自动填充功能可以节省时间
- 仔细核对:特别是姓名、护照号码等关键信息
- 保存草稿:大多数系统支持保存草稿功能
代码示例:使用浏览器自动填充的JavaScript代码(仅作说明)
// 这是一个概念性示例,实际使用时浏览器会自动处理
// 假设表单字段有明确的name属性
document.querySelector('input[name="firstName"]').value = '张三';
document.querySelector('input[name="lastName"]').value = '李四';
document.querySelector('input[name="passportNumber"]').value = 'E12345678';
// 注意:实际操作中请手动填写,确保准确性
第三步:上传文件
文件准备技巧:
- 文件命名规范:使用英文命名,如passport_scan.pdf
- 文件格式:通常支持PDF、JPG、PNG
- 文件大小:提前压缩文件到系统要求的大小范围内
- 文件质量:确保扫描件清晰可读
文件处理示例(使用Python进行文件压缩):
import os
from PIL import Image
import PyPDF2
def compress_image(input_path, output_path, max_size_mb=2):
"""压缩图片到指定大小"""
img = Image.open(input_path)
# 逐步降低质量直到文件大小符合要求
quality = 95
while True:
img.save(output_path, 'JPEG', quality=quality)
size = os.path.getsize(output_path) / (1024 * 1024) # MB
if size <= max_size_mb or quality <= 10:
break
quality -= 5
print(f"压缩后文件大小: {size:.2f} MB")
def compress_pdf(input_path, output_path, max_size_mb=2):
"""压缩PDF文件"""
with open(input_path, 'rb') as file:
reader = PyPDF2.PdfReader(file)
writer = PyPDF2.PdfWriter()
for page in reader.pages:
writer.add_page(page)
with open(output_path, 'wb') as output_file:
writer.write(output_file)
size = os.path.getsize(output_path) / (1024 * 1024)
print(f"PDF压缩后大小: {size:.2f} MB")
# 使用示例
# compress_image('passport.jpg', 'passport_compressed.jpg')
# compress_pdf('document.pdf', 'document_compressed.pdf')
第四步:支付流程
支付前检查清单:
- 确认支付金额和货币
- 检查支付方式是否可用
- 确保支付卡有足够额度
- 了解可能的手续费
支付流程优化技巧:
- 使用信用卡支付:通常处理速度最快
- 避免高峰期:避开系统维护时间(通常在当地时间凌晨)
- 准备好3D验证:部分银行需要短信验证码
- 记录交易号:保存支付确认页面截图
支付处理代码示例(模拟支付流程):
import requests
import json
from datetime import datetime
class VisaPaymentProcessor:
def __init__(self, api_key, endpoint):
self.api_key = api_key
self.endpoint = endpoint
self.headers = {
'Content-Type': 'application/json',
'Authorization': f'Bearer {api_key}'
}
def process_payment(self, card_details, amount, currency='USD'):
"""处理支付请求"""
payment_data = {
'amount': amount,
'currency': currency,
'card': {
'number': card_details['number'],
'expiry_month': card_details['expiry_month'],
'expiry_year': card_details['expiry_year'],
'cvv': card_details['cvv']
},
'metadata': {
'application_id': 'evisa_123456',
'timestamp': datetime.now().isoformat()
}
}
try:
response = requests.post(
f'{self.endpoint}/payments',
headers=self.headers,
json=payment_data,
timeout=30
)
if response.status_code == 200:
result = response.json()
return {
'success': True,
'transaction_id': result.get('id'),
'status': result.get('status'),
'message': '支付成功'
}
else:
return {
'success': False,
'error': response.text,
'message': '支付失败'
}
except requests.exceptions.RequestException as e:
return {
'success': False,
'error': str(e),
'message': '网络连接错误'
}
# 使用示例(注意:这是模拟代码,实际支付需要真实API)
# processor = VisaPaymentProcessor('your_api_key', 'https://api.paymentgateway.com')
# card_info = {
# 'number': '4111111111111111', # 测试卡号
# 'expiry_month': '12',
# 'expiry_year': '2025',
# 'cvv': '123'
# }
# result = processor.process_payment(card_info, 150.00, 'USD')
# print(result)
第五步:确认与保存
重要操作:
- 保存确认页面:截图或打印支付成功页面
- 记录交易号:通常以”REF”或”Transaction ID”开头
- 检查邮箱:确认邮件通常在5-30分钟内到达
- 下载签证文件:批准后立即下载PDF签证文件
常见问题与解决方案
1. 支付失败怎么办?
可能原因:
- 银行卡余额不足
- 银行卡未开通国际支付功能
- 支付网关临时故障
- 网络连接不稳定
解决方案:
- 检查银行卡余额和支付限额
- 联系银行开通国际支付功能
- 尝试更换支付方式(如从信用卡改为PayPal)
- 等待15分钟后重试
- 联系签证申请系统客服
2. 系统卡顿或崩溃怎么办?
应急措施:
- 不要重复提交:避免重复支付
- 清除缓存:清除浏览器缓存和Cookie
- 更换浏览器:尝试使用不同的浏览器
- 保存进度:如果可能,保存当前进度
- 联系技术支持:通过官方渠道寻求帮助
3. 支付后未收到确认邮件怎么办?
排查步骤:
- 检查垃圾邮件文件夹
- 确认邮箱地址输入正确
- 等待至少30分钟
- 登录申请系统查看状态
- 联系客服提供交易号查询
不同国家电子签证支付系统对比
| 国家 | 系统复杂度 | 支付方式 | 处理时间 | 中文支持 | 费用范围 |
|---|---|---|---|---|---|
| 印度 | 中等 | 信用卡、借记卡 | 72小时 | 部分 | 10-80美元 |
| 土耳其 | 简单 | 信用卡、PayPal | 24小时 | 是 | 60美元 |
| 澳大利亚 | 简单 | 信用卡、借记卡 | 24小时 | 是 | 140澳元 |
| 新西兰 | 简单 | 信用卡、借记卡 | 24小时 | 是 | 177新西兰元 |
| 斯里兰卡 | 简单 | 信用卡 | 24小时 | 部分 | 35美元 |
安全注意事项
1. 防范钓鱼网站
- 检查网址:确保是官方域名
- 查看安全证书:确认有HTTPS和锁标志
- 警惕可疑链接:不要点击邮件中的可疑链接
- 使用官方APP:部分国家提供官方移动应用
2. 保护个人信息
- 不要在公共电脑操作:避免在网吧或公共电脑上申请
- 使用安全网络:避免使用公共Wi-Fi进行支付
- 定期更改密码:如果系统有账户功能
- 不分享支付信息:不要向他人透露支付详情
3. 支付安全
- 使用虚拟信用卡:部分银行提供一次性虚拟卡号
- 设置支付限额:临时降低信用卡限额
- 启用交易提醒:开通短信/邮件交易通知
- 保留证据:保存所有支付凭证
优化支付体验的高级技巧
1. 使用密码管理器
推荐工具:
- LastPass
- 1Password
- Bitwarden
- Chrome内置密码管理器
优势:
- 自动填充表单
- 生成强密码
- 安全存储支付信息
- 跨设备同步
2. 利用浏览器扩展
推荐扩展:
- Grammarly:检查拼写错误
- Google Translate:翻译非母语界面
- AdBlock:屏蔽干扰广告
- HTTPS Everywhere:强制安全连接
3. 批量处理技巧
如果需要为多人申请:
- 使用表格模板:创建Excel模板批量填写信息
- 分批提交:避免同时提交过多申请
- 记录状态:使用电子表格跟踪每个申请的状态
- 设置提醒:为每个申请设置处理时间提醒
未来发展趋势
1. 生物识别集成
- 指纹识别
- 面部识别
- 虹膜扫描
2. 区块链技术应用
- 去中心化身份验证
- 不可篡改的签证记录
- 跨国互认系统
3. 人工智能辅助
- 智能表单填写
- 自动文件审核
- 实时问题解答
4. 移动端优化
- 专用移动应用
- 离线申请功能
- 推送通知提醒
总结与建议
电子签证支付系统的操作复杂度因国家而异,但通过充分准备和掌握技巧,大多数用户都能在30分钟内完成整个流程。关键要点包括:
- 提前准备:收集所有必要文件并确保符合要求
- 选择合适时间:避开系统维护和高峰期
- 使用可靠设备:确保网络稳定和浏览器兼容
- 仔细核对:特别是支付信息和个人信息
- 保存记录:保留所有确认和交易记录
对于经常需要申请电子签证的用户,建议:
- 创建个人签证申请档案
- 使用密码管理器存储常用信息
- 关注官方通知和系统更新
- 加入相关论坛获取最新经验分享
通过遵循这些指导,您可以显著提高电子签证支付的成功率和效率,使整个申请过程更加顺畅和可靠。
